Based on the Emmy-winning PBS Kids show PEG + CAT, this totally awesome musical features wild comedy, countless favorite songs from the show, and Peg’s super coolest pal Ramone! When Peg’s Mom asks Peg and Cat to mail some really important letters, they come face to face with a really big dog. Really Big Problem! To solve it, they’ll need math—bar graphs, size comparison, position words, fair sharing, and a whole lot of counting. They’ll also need to count on each other, and the audience too, for their problem to be solved.

The vibrant full-scale production features larger-than-life puppets, light-up math facts that pop up all over the stage, and fan-favorite songs from the series, enhanced for the live stage experience!

With an original story written by series co-creators Jennifer Oxley (Little Bill, The Wonder Pets!) and Billy Aronson (Rent, Postcards from Buster), the stage show promises a totally awesome time for young “problem solvers” as they embark on an interactive adventure with their favorite characters from the series, including Peg, Cat, Ramone, Big Dog, Pig, Mermaid, and more, to solve a REALLY BIG problem.

“We’re delighted to work with the Brad Simon Organization and Bay Area Children’s Theatre to bring Peg + Cat to life on stage for the very first time,” said Paul Siefken, President and CEO, Fred Rogers Productions. “With this new live production, preschoolers and their families will get to engage with their favorite characters and stories from the popular series while honing their early math skills all along the way.”

Peg + Cat, now in its fifth year on PBS KIDS, has earned six Daytime Emmy® Awards, including for “Outstanding Preschool Children’s Animated Program,” “Outstanding Writing in a Preschool Animated Program,” and “Outstanding Music Direction and Composition.”

The hit series follows the adorable, spirited Peg and her loyal sidekick Cat, as they embark on a host of hilarious, musical adventures, learning foundational math concepts along the way. Each episode features engaging stories in which Peg and Cat encounter a problem that requires them to use math and problem-solving skills to move the story forward. The series provides young viewers with new ways to experience math and highlights its importance in a variety of everyday situations.
